Ethanol in-wall bio fireplaces can be hung or recessed into the wall, and many designs come with the essential hardware for either setup. Nevertheless, it is necessary to keep in mind that the wall on which you hang a recessed fireplace needs to be made from non-combustible products. These include concrete backer board, such as HardieBacker and Wonderboard, and fire-resistant drywall.

The initial step in installing a wall-mounted ethanol fireplace is to choose where you would like it to be positioned. It should be a location far from any combustible materials and easily available for refilling the ethanol fuel. It ought to also be an area that permits proper ventilation. This is essential since ethanol fireplaces produce co2 when they burn. This CO2 can develop a hazardous atmosphere if it is not correctly ventilated.
When you have actually decided on a place for the fireplace, you will require to inspect its load-bearing capacity and fire-resistance products. If these are not adequate, a various type of installation need to be considered. For example, a mantel bio ethanol fireplace or another type of freestanding bio ethanol fire can be utilized rather.
You will then require to prepare the wall on which you wish to hang your ethanol fireplace. Ideally, it should be constructed of non-combustible material. These consist of concrete backer boards (HardieBacker, DuRock, & & Wonderboard), brick masonry, or cement blocks. It ought to also be painted with a heat-resistant paint.
Next, mark the areas on the wall where you prepare to mount the fireplace. Utilizing a stud finder, find the studs in the wall. Using a drill, make holes at the significant positions in the wall. These holes will be utilized to secure the mounting bracket. The bracket needs to be screwed into the studs for the best setup.
As soon as the studs are secured, you can mount your fireplace. Before you do this, however, make sure that the ethanol fireplace is fully sustained. It is a good idea to install the fireplace in a space with a window open. This is due to the fact that ethanol fires produce carbon dioxide, which can be unsafe in little rooms without appropriate ventilation.
